Overview OSP Construction Manager

– Tower Engineering Professionals (TEP) is seeking a full-time

Construction Manager

in our Raleigh, NC office. As an OSP Construction Manager, you will serve as an integral member of our construction team. TEP offers a comprehensive benefits package including medical and dental insurance, paid vacation and holidays, 401k with company match, and a relaxed, fun environment.

Location Raleigh, NC

Responsibilities

Communicate schedules and priorities, construction standards, and task delegation to sub-contractors and TEP inspectors, and communicate effectively with customers and authorities having jurisdiction (homeowners, inspectors, and other contractors).

Coordinate proposed work, track production, and drive quality and safety standards with sub-contractors in accordance with project specifications.

Report current and future production and challenges to management.

Monitor and ensure schedule performance and quality workmanship of sub-contractors; review and approve contractor payment requests.

Manage, maintain, and grow vendor relations across various projects and manage multiple customers.

Use local market knowledge to find new clients/customers to grow the TEP Fiber customer base.

Prepare competitive project bids and maintain a 25% profit margin throughout the construction process.

Maintain/generate a monthly income target (e.g., for the Tampa Construction Office) as part of financial planning.

Collaborate with upper management on yearly budgets, goals, and expectations.

Participate in interviewing and recruiting per team needs (e.g., Splicer or Operators).

Qualifications

Minimum 5 years of experience with Directional Drilling equipment, including Directional Drill Rigs, trenching equipment (mini excavators, ditch witch, plows, etc.), and aerial installation methods.

Minimum 5 years of experience with Horizontal Directional Drilling standards, including 811 services, all DOT and local municipality general requirements, and OSHA safety requirements.

Ability to read and interpret blueprints, including generating redlines and As-Builts.

Excellent organizational and communication skills to work with project managers, vendors, sub-contractors, and customers.

Physical ability to stand, bend, squat, walk, move, lift, and carry equipment (>50 lb) for the duration of the workday.

Ability to travel 3–5 days per week.

Experience with Google Earth and Microsoft Office (Outlook, Excel, Word, OneNote); Smartsheet and Box experience preferred.

Self-disciplined and self-motivated.

Valid driver’s license and a clean motor vehicle report (MVR) dating back 5 years.
